Frances ellen watkins harper september 24, 1825 february 22, 1911 was an abolitionist, suffragist, poet, teacher, public speaker, and writer, one of the first african american women to be published in the united states. Womens suffrage in the united states of america, the legal right of women to vote, was established over the course of more than half a century, first in various states and localities, sometimes on a limited basis, and then nationally in 1920. The delegates who attended these conventions consisted of both free and fugitive african americans including religious leaders, businessmen, politicians, writers, publishers, and abolitionists. Philadelphia was the hub of the colored conventions movement for several years before nearby cities such as new york city, albany, and pittsburgh also started hosting conventions. The colored conventions movement, or negro convention movement, was a series of national, regional, and state conventions held irregularly during the decades preceding and following the american civil war.
